Daniels Fast Recipe Vegan Fish Tacos Ingredients [ ]2 14 oz cans hearts of palm , drained & rinsed [ ]1 tablespoon vegan butter , melted [ ]1 tablespoon lime juice , freshly squeezed... [ ]1 teaspoon chili powder [ ] teaspoon ground cumin [ ] - teaspoon cayenne pepper [ ] teaspoon granulated garlic [ ] teaspoon sea salt , more to taste [ ] - 1 tablespoon kelp granules (*see note for sub) Cilantro-Lime Corn Slaw [ ] cup vegan mayo [ ]1-2 tablespoons lime juice , freshly squeezed [ ]2 teaspoons agave nectar (sub maple syrup) [ ]1 fresh jalapeño , deseeded & minced [ ] teaspoon granulated garlic [ ] teaspoon sea salt , more to taste [ ]2 cups purple cabbage , shredded or chopped [ ]1 cup frozen corn kernels , thawed [ ] cup cilantro , chopped To Serve [ ]10 corn tortillas [ ]1 avocado , peeled and cubed Instructions 1. Preheat oven to 425 F (220 C). Lightly grease or line a large baking tray/dish with parchment paper. 2. Add the hearts of palm to a food processor and give 2-3 long pulses, until shredded. Don't over process. The mixture should have a fish-like consistency. (*see photo above). If your processor is small, blend in two batches. 3. To a med-large bowl, add vegan butter, lime juice, chili powder, ground cumin, cayenne pepper, granulated garlic & sea salt. Whisk to combine well. 4. Add shredded hearts of palm to the bowl and gently combine. Now add tablespoon of the kelp granules and combine. Taste before adding tablespoon more, so you can determine how much ocean flavor you'd like. 5. Place on your prepared baking tray/dish in one layer. Bake for 10-12 minutes, until lightly browned on some edges. Cilantro-Lime Corn Slaw 1. In a large bowl, whisk together the vegan mayonnaise, lime juice, agave nectar, granulated garlic & sea salt. Now add the cabbage, corn, jalapeño, and cilantro. Combine well. Taco Assembly 1. Place a tortilla in a cast iron or stainless steel skillet over medium heat (don't add oil). Cook for 30 seconds on each side. Remove and cover with a slightly damp dish towel to keep warm. Repeat with remaining tortillas. 2. Assemble tacos, by adding a few tablespoons of hearts of palm mixture. Top with slaw and cubed avocado. Serve immediately. * Serve with vegan sour cream, salsa, hot sauce or lime wedges on the side if desired. Notes * If you can't find kelp granules, you can use dulse flakes, dulse granules or break up a small piece of nori. If you don't want the ocean-like flavor, you can omit the seaweed altogether. It will still be delicious! * These tacos have a medium spice to them. Feel free to omit or reduce the amount of cayenne pepper or fresh jalapeño for a milder versio
